Children’s Bereavement Team can help children and teenagers to make some sense of illness and loss using a range of activities and therapies.
Their counselling services are available to children and young people who do not have a connection to St Cuthbert’s Hospice, as well as those related to hospice patients.
The Jigsaw Project at St Cuthbert’s Hospice is a counselling service for young adults and children who have experienced grief, loss and bereavement, around life-limiting illnesses and palliative care, unexpected or sudden death including suicide, road traffic accidents and murder.
Referrals to The Jigsaw Project can be made by self-referral, a parent or family member, school, primary health care team, mental health care teams or social workers.
